1. a sacred place, such as a temple, mosque or church
2. Every year, he goes to the monastery, which he considers is a sanctuary for him.
3. A reserved area in which birds and animals are protected from hunting or molestation.
4. a place of refuge or asylum

1. The forbidding jungle offered sanctuary to the guerilla rebels.
2. There is always a risk that a student may prove incompatible with their placement.
3. The church provided him sanctuary.

